ABSTRACT:Copolymerization of ethylene with vinyl acetate was carried out at room temperature by the ternary catalyst system consisting of equimolar amounts of AlEts, ZnCh and CCk By solvent fractionation and thin layer chromatography analysis, the copolymerization product was found to consist of two different copolymer fractions. One was the 1 : 1 alternating copolymer and the other was identified with the copolymer produced by the usual free radical initiator under the same reaction conditions.
